Jahkobi
Pronounced jah-KOH-bee /dʒɑːˈkoʊ.bi/Medium
Meaning: Jahkobi is a modern respelling in the Jacoby and Jakobi family, from Jacob — Hebrew Yaakov, traditionally read as 'holder of the heel' or 'supplanter.' The Jah- opening is a contemporary American styling, so the spelling's route is uncertain, which we note.Low
History & Origin
Jahkobi is part of a lively American tradition of reshaping Jacob — Jakobe, Jacoby, Jakobi, Jahkobi — each spelling giving the ancient Hebrew name Yaakov a fresh beat. The meaning behind it is documented; the spelling itself is recent and its route uncertain, which we note (said 'jah-KOH-bee').
In the U.S. this spelling is very rare. Rare as spelled, familiar in sound.

Frequently Asked
What does the name Jahkobi mean?
Jahkobi respells Jacoby, from Hebrew Jacob, 'holder of the heel' or 'supplanter.' The spelling's route is uncertain, which we note.
How do you pronounce Jahkobi?
It's said jah-KOH-bee /dʒɑːˈkoʊ.bi/ — three syllables, stress on the second.
Is Jahkobi a boy or girl name?
Jahkobi is used as a boy's name.
How popular is Jahkobi?
Jahkobi is a very rare spelling in the U.S., while Jacob is a long-time favorite.
